Are balance beams padded?
The balance beam; usually referred to simply as beam, is a women's gymnastics event. A traditional competition beam is raised about 4 feet off the ground, measures 4 inches wide, and is 16 ½ feet long from end to end. The beam balance is a device used for the determination of the mass of a body under gravitation. It consists of a beam supported at the centre by an agate knife edge resting on a support moving inside a vertical pillar. What is a triple beam balance used for in science?
The triple beam balance is an instrument used to measure mass very precisely. The device has reading error of +/- 0.05 gram. What are uneven bars made of?
The uneven bars or asymmetric bars is an artistic gymnastics apparatus. It is made of a steel frame. The bars are made of fiberglass with wood coating, or less commonly wood.
